aws-mwaa-local-runner
This repository provides a command line interface (CLI) utility that replicates an Amazon Managed Workflows for Apache Airflow (MWAA) environment locally.

Spray
A suite of scala libraries for building and consuming RESTful web services on top of Akka: lightweight, asynchronous, non-blocking, actor-based, testable

runfinch/finch is an open source project licensed under Apache License 2.0 which is an OSI approved license.
The primary programming language of finch is Go.
